ROBERT GRIBBIN Activities: Football 2, 3, 4; Captain 4; Band 1, 2, 3, 4; Alpha 1, 2, 3. 4; Latin Club 1, 2, 3; Business Manager of Profile. Captain of our splendid football team, Bob led the boys through a victorious season culminating in Nassau County Championship. His clean, hard playing indicated that he possesses all the qualities which epitomize the real sportsman. Not only is “Gusto” an outstanding athlete but also a reliable student, as attests his four year membership in the Alpha Society.
